Comparing the Impact of Public and Peer Platforms

Google is often the first and final stop for a potential client searching for help. A high rating on a business profile provides instant visibility that can bypass traditional search rankings. It is the most accessible way for a stranger to gauge the firm quality.

Directories like Avvo or Martindale Hubbell offer a different type of validation for the more cautious researcher. These sites focus on professional standing and peer endorsements rather than just public sentiment. They provide a layer of professional legitimacy that a general search engine might lack.

Balancing both platforms is necessary for a comprehensive reputation strategy. While Google drives the most traffic, specialized directories often attract clients who are deeper in the decision-making process. Having a presence on both ensures no opportunities are missed when someone is ready to sign.

Addressing Criticism with Professionalism and Ethics

Receiving a negative review can feel like a personal attack on a lawyer professional character. However, these moments are actually opportunities to demonstrate grace and a commitment to client satisfaction. How a firm responds to criticism often matters more to readers than the original complaint.

Professionalism must remain the top priority when drafting a response to a frustrated individual. It is vital to avoid getting defensive or disclosing any confidential details about the case in a public forum. A calm and helpful tone shows potential clients that the firm takes concerns seriously.

Offering to take the conversation offline is the best way to handle a dispute ethically. This shows that the attorney is willing to listen and find a resolution without engaging in a public shouting match. Handling conflict with maturity builds a reputation for being a reasonable advocate.

Staying Relevant through Frequency and Review Volume

Search engines prioritize active and growing profiles over static ones that have not been updated in years. A firm with five hundred reviews from five years ago will often lose out to a competitor with fifty recent ones. Consistent activity signals that the business is still thriving.

Volume is equally important because it provides a larger sample size for a cautious researcher to evaluate. A handful of perfect five star ratings can look suspicious or even fabricated to a skeptical visitor. Having a high number of honest reviews creates an authentic digital footprint.

Encouraging satisfied clients to share their experiences should be a routine part of the closing process. Making it easy for them to leave feedback ensures a steady stream of fresh content for the profiles. This continuous growth keeps the firm visible in a crowded market.
